About Lower Earley

Lower Earley, a suburb of Earley in Berkshire, England, is characterized by its predominantly lower-density residential environment along the northern banks of the River Loddon. This area experienced significant growth through extensive development in the late 20th century and features a district centre that includes a supermarket, making it a focal point for local amenities and services.

Planning Activity in Lower Earley

In the last 24 months, 53 planning applications were submitted near Lower Earley. Of these, 84% were approved, with an average decision time of 57 days.

This is broadly in line with the national average of approximately 87%. Lower Earley maintains a standard approach to planning decisions.

At 57 days on average, decisions near Lower Earley slightly exceed the 8-week statutory target for minor applications, though this is common across many councils.

The most common application types near Lower Earley were full planning applications (11), outline applications (5), discharge of conditions (2). Full planning applications account for 21% of all submissions, covering new builds, change of use, and works that go beyond permitted development rights.

In terms of development scale, 4 medium-scale applications, 49 smaller schemes were submitted. The absence of major applications suggests the area is primarily characterised by smaller-scale improvements and extensions rather than large new developments.

3 planning appeals were lodged, of which 1 was allowed and 2 were dismissed (33% success rate).
